Block

#18,131,829
Block Number
18,131,829 @ 03/25/2024, 06:55:10
Status
Finalized
ID
0x0114ab75e7f90d3fff0875267a39df1e8ff861a160b297e304f07186ce201427
Transactions
Gas Used
136754/30000000 (0.46% Used)
Total Score
148,396,938 (+14)
Rewards
0.41 VTHO